Description

Welcome Home! This 2011 built, modern, 5 bedroom, 3 bathroom home has all the luxuries you deserve! The main floor features 9 foot ceilings, hardwood and tile floors, and an open-concept layout! The gorgeous classic kitchen includes stainless steel appliances, glass tile backsplash, and an island/breakfast bar. The Primary bedroom has rear patio access and a separate shower and jetted soaker tub! In the basement you'll find a huge rec-room/media room and a tastefully updated bathroom with a glass & tile shower. Don't worry about staying cool all summer with the Central A/C. Outside there is a fenced, private yard, a heated double garage with 10 ft ceilings, and a paved driveway with lots of parking! All this in a great neighbourhood! Quick possession available! Minimum down payment: 5% on the first $500,000, 10% on the portion up to $1.5M, 20% at/above $1.5M. Stress test: OSFI's minimum qualifying rate, the greater of contract rate + 2% or 5.25% — this is what lenders require you to qualify at, not what you'll actually pay. Closing costs are a typical-range estimate, not a quote — actual legal fees vary. Verify all figures with a mortgage broker and lawyer before relying on them.
